Operating Instructions

Inserting the memory card

1. Place the Micro Sd card into the card slot carefully

2. If the device does not recognize the card, try removing and reinserting

Turning Device On and Off

1. Connect the car power adapter to the car 12V/24V DC socket.

2. Press POWER button to turn on the car camera.

3. After the car is started and power is provided to the DC power port, the

car camera will start recording automatically.

4. After the car has been turned off and the car camera is no longer receiving

power, it will automatically store all recorded data and power down by

itself.

Reset

If device powers on but is not operating properly, press reset button and

power on again, this will reset the car camera do default settings.

Switching modes

MLG-7117CVR has three functional modes: video, photo, and playback.

Press the MODE button to switch.

Video not Recording:

- Try a different Micro Sd card

- Change the recording resolution, frames per second.

- Make sure the card has been installed correctly (during the installation

process, you should hear a clicking sound).

- Delete unnecessary files from the memory card to release space.

Video is not clear:

- Ensure that the camera lens is clean.

- Wipe off the dust and dirt on the lens

Buttons on the camera is not responding:

- Press the reset button to reset to factory default
